The Caecus Verderón White Wine from D.O. Rioja is made with 95% Viura and 5% Malvasía. With 5 months of aging in American oak barrels, it stands out for its freshness, citrus notes, and a persistent finish. Perfect for pairing with seafood and fish.
The Caecus Verderón white wine is a true enological gem from the D.O. Rioja. Primarily made from 95% Viura and 5% Malvasía, this wine is produced through the manual harvesting of grapes. Its must ferments in American oak barrels for 5 months, where 'batonnage' enriches its complexity and volume while maintaining freshness and fruity character. From vineyards in Elciego, Alava, at the La Romañiguez estate, and made by Bodegas Pago de Larrea, the Caecus Verderón shines with its bright pale yellow color and intense aromatic expression, with notes ranging from white fruits like apple and banana to soft floral and vanilla hints. On the palate, it is balanced and fresh, inviting another sip with its persistent finish. This white wine pairs well with a variety of dishes, ideal for accompanying seafood, fish, salads, and soft cheeses, enhancing each bite.
